Question

on a sheet of paper, draw the lewis structure for the following compound. a link to the periodic table has been provided for you. sci₂
sample answer: :cl—s—cl:
check all features below that you included in your lewis structure.
correct number of s and cl atoms
s as the central atom
link (single bond) between s and each of the two cl atoms
six dots (electrons) associated with each cl atom
four dots (electrons) associated with the s atom
no other lines or dots

Explanation:

Step1: Determine central atom

Sulfur (S) is less electronegative than chlorine (Cl), so S is the central atom.

Step2: Calculate valence - electrons

S has 6 valence electrons and each Cl has 7 valence electrons. Total valence electrons = 6+(2×7)=20.

Step3: Form single - bonds

Form single bonds (S - Cl) between S and each Cl atom. 2 single bonds use 4 electrons.

Step4: Distribute remaining electrons

We have 20 - 4 = 16 electrons left. Place 6 electrons as 3 lone - pairs around each Cl atom and 4 electrons as 2 lone - pairs around the S atom.

Answer:

All of the features should be checked:

  • correct number of S and Cl atoms
  • S as the central atom
  • single bond between S and each of the two Cl atoms
  • six dots (electrons) associated with each Cl atom
  • four dots (electrons) associated with the S atom
  • no other lines or dots
